Overview
Our Broad Peak expedition spans 52 days, starting from your arrival in Islamabad. This journey is designed for climbers who have previously tackled 6000 or 7000-meter peaks and are ready for their next big challenge. The adventure begins with a flight to Skardu, followed by a scenic drive to Askole, the starting point of the trek.
The trek to Base Camp takes you through some of the most spectacular landscapes in Pakistan, including the famous Baltoro Glacier. You will trek alongside towering peaks, cross glacial rivers, and camp under the stars. Each day brings new vistas and challenges as you acclimatize and prepare for the climb ahead.
Base Camp at 4900 meters serves as the staging ground for the ascent. Here, you will meet our experienced Sherpa guides, undergo thorough gear checks, and participate in training sessions to refine your climbing skills. The route to the summit follows the West Ridge, a combination of snow and rock that requires technical proficiency and stamina. The climb involves setting up three high camps, each progressively higher, to ensure proper acclimatization.
The summit push is a test of endurance and determination. Starting in the early hours, you will ascend through the night, reaching the summit of Broad Peak at 8051 meters. From the top, the view of the Karakoram Range, including K2, is breathtaking. After celebrating your achievement, you will descend to Base Camp and begin the journey back to Islamabad.
